Cyclic Olefin Polymer Market Overview
The Cyclic Olefin Polymer (COP) market holds a significant and steadily growing valuation within the high-performance thermoplastics industry. This category of materials, which includes both homopolymers and copolymers, is distinguished by remarkable properties such as excellent optical clarity, high chemical inertness, and low moisture absorption, rendering it an essential alternative to conventional glass and commodity plastics in challenging environments.
Current market trends are heavily shaped by the rigorous demands of the life sciences sector. COPs are increasingly favored for pharmaceutical packaging, particularly in pre-filled syringes and vials, owing to their ultra-pure composition and minimal extractables profile, which guarantee the stability of sensitive biologic drug formulations. The growth of the market is further bolstered by the rise of diagnostic devices, including microfluidic chips, where the polymer’s dimensional stability is crucial. Moreover, adoption is gaining traction in specialized flexible packaging applications that necessitate superior barrier properties, as well as in the optics and electronics sectors for display films and high-frequency components. Manufacturing efficiency is enhanced by the widespread use of specialized processing methods such as injection molding and extrusion.

Cyclic Olefin Polymer Market Impact on Industry
The Cyclic Olefin Polymer (COP) market is significantly influencing the Healthcare and Life Sciences sectors by facilitating the advancement of diagnostics and drug delivery systems. The material’s glass-like clarity, exceptional purity, and outstanding chemical inertness, along with its extremely low levels of extractables and leachables, render it essential. This enables pharmaceutical companies to securely package sensitive biologic drugs and vaccines that cannot be stored in conventional glass, thereby reducing contamination risks and maintaining drug effectiveness. COPs are critical to the expansion of point-of-care diagnostics and microfluidic devices, where their dimensional stability and low birefringence are vital for precise optical sensing and the fabrication of complex fluidic channels for swift disease testing.
The market serves as a key disruptor in the Specialty Packaging and Film sectors. COP films and resins offer an ideal blend of moisture barrier capabilities and high transparency, which greatly prolongs the shelf life and preserves the quality of sensitive food and pharmaceutical items. This performance enables packagers to comply with increasingly rigorous food safety and pharmaceutical standards while also adapting to the trend of material lightweighting and potentially enhanced recyclability compared to intricate multi-layer plastics. By delivering high performance in thinner profiles, COP contributes to sustainability objectives through material reduction.
The characteristics of COPs are propelling advancements in the Optics and Electronics industries. The polymer’s outstanding optical transmission and minimal birefringence render it highly sought after for precision optical components, such as camera lenses, advanced display films, and optical sensors. The material’s high thermal resistance and capability to be injection-molded into intricate, precise shapes are crucial for components utilized in consumer electronics and advanced automotive sensors, where exceptional image quality and long-term stability in challenging environments are essential requirements.
Cyclic Olefin Polymer Market Dynamics:
Cyclic Olefin Polymer Market Drivers
The primary driver behind the growth of the Cyclic Olefin Polymer (COP) market is the consistent demand from the pharmaceutical and life sciences sectors for ultra-high-purity materials. With the rapid advancement of sensitive biologic drugs, personalized medicines, and cutting-edge vaccines, there is an essential requirement for packaging and delivery systems that are chemically inert, exhibit extremely low leachables, and maintain the stability of drug formulations more effectively than traditional glass. This rigorous demand for material quality results in a sustained, high-value need for COP. This demand is further bolstered by the increasing miniaturization and complexity of medical diagnostic devices. COPs play a crucial role in microfluidic chips, point-of-care devices, and sophisticated optical sensors, where their dimensional stability, optical clarity, and ease of precision injection molding are vital for accurate performance and mass production.
Challenges
A notable challenge confronting the COP market is the limited awareness and comprehension of the material’s properties beyond niche, high-end applications. COP is not a commodity plastic; its distinct processing requirements and cost structure often lead manufacturers in less-specialized sectors to overlook it in favor of established, lower-cost polymers. This lack of general market knowledge hinders its broader adoption in high-volume consumer or industrial products. Furthermore, the market continually faces challenges from the availability of other high-performance polymer alternatives, such as specific grades of polycarbonate or specialty polyamides. These competing materials frequently fulfill many of the necessary performance criteria (such as transparency or heat resistance) at a more competitive price or with more established processing capabilities, compelling COP manufacturers to consistently demonstrate the superior, unique advantages of their material for critical applications.
Opportunities
The market offers a significant opportunity through the increased use of COP in both advanced flexible and rigid packaging that necessitates enhanced barrier properties. As the food and pharmaceutical sectors progressively seek packaging solutions that prolong shelf life and safeguard against oxygen and moisture penetration, the outstanding barrier capabilities of COP films present a valuable growth opportunity. Additionally, there is a notable chance to utilize COP’s distinctive optical features for next-generation electronics and display technologies. Its excellent thermal stability and minimal birefringence render it an optimal material for advanced display films, camera lenses, and components in 5G communication systems and specialized automotive sensors, where exceptional light transmission and signal integrity are crucial and can justify a considerable price premium.
